Subject: Schema registry update for event producers

Welcome to the team. This week's release adds compatibility enforcement to the Wrenhall schema registry: new event schemas must pass backward-compatibility checks before registration. Existing producers are unaffected, but any schema bump now requires a passing validation run in staging. Full details are in the onboarding wiki. The release is tracked by the token below.

pipeline stamp: htk3_a71

Scope: nightly fuel-usage rollup for the Granton depot fleet. Job runs at 02:10 on reporter-01. If the report is empty, check that the telemetry export finished (marker file in /var/haulmetric/done). If totals look doubled, the dedupe step failed — rerun with HM_DEDUPE=force. Maintainers: the reporter pulls odometer data from the Vanewick telemetry API and will silently emit zeros if unauthenticated. Open /etc/haulmetric/reporter.env and confirm the API credential is set on the line directly below this sentence.

sealed setting: ARCHIVE_KEY3=8d0

Hi — handover before I'm off-site this week. The spare hardware room at Grayfall Annexe (Room B14, past the lift lobby) has everything the contractors from Pellam Works might need: monitors on the left shelving, cables in the labelled crates, and the docking stations in the grey cabinet. Please keep the sign-out sheet on the door updated. To let the contractors in, use the code below.

staff pass of kawip-hawef = bdg-QLP-2